for those trying to get dd-wrt on a newer router where the firmware upgrade process is locked .. the instructions here were not clear to me.. this is what i did.

1. the newer firmwares will not allow flashing dd-wrt.trx file or even an older asus stock firmware that did allow it.

2. the recovery partition on the router also will not allow it.. you can get to recovvery by long holding the reset and you will be in recovery when the one light is flashing slowly... do not reboot..
just hard code your ip on your pc plugged into the router to something on 192.168.1.x
ie 192.168.1.12 the router should be at 192.168.1.1

now the built in recovery as i said if you open a web browser to 192.168.1.1 also will not allow the firmware upgrade. it must also have checks.. it doesnt tell you that the submit or whatever button just does nothing..

3. you need to have previously downloaded and setup a version of asus firmware recovery i used this version

https://dlcdnets.asus.com/pub/ASUS/wireless/RT-AC5300/Rescue_RT_AC5300_2000.zip

you can use any dd-wrt rt-5300 specific trx file
like this

https://dd-wrt.com/support/router-database/?model=RT-AC5300_-

once it boots up you should be good to go.. i have had problems getting it to take the new username password.. i think you need to do a reset first and then the second time it took it.

now you can install any version of dd-wrt..

Yes. Both are currently set to Singapore / non 802.11d/h mode (default).

As previous posters have mentioned, it doesn’t matter the domain specified, the AC5300 doesn’t respond with any available DFS channels.

This may be related to how the radios are initialized and capabilities of the way different firmwares operate. Radios certified after 2015 may require to use GPS, adjacent APs, local cellular frequencies and radar detection to verify operating locale and subsequently enable all frequencies / capabilities. If not, only the most basic capabilities are enabled.

FCC Guidance

Also could be the encrypted CFE is detecting an unsigned / invalidly signed firmware and ensures compliance by disabling the advanced features. I don’t have a console connection to verify either assumption.
